Luxury Manifesto

"Luxury Manifesto album by Scott Storch on Archodia Music"

Release Date: 2025-07-11T00:00:00.000000Z

  • Luxury Manifesto
  • Long Distance
  • Livin Life
  • Smoke and Stack
  • Luxury Manifesto - Radio Edit